Explore the Best of London: A 7-Day City Experiences Itinerary

Embark on a fascinating journey through the eclectic city of London. Immerse yourself in its rich history, iconic landmarks, and vibrant culture while enjoying a variety of city experiences. This 7-day itinerary offers a perfect balance of must-visit attractions and off-the-beaten-path gems that will leave you with unforgettable memories.

Friday, December 15: Arrival and Introduction to London

Welcome to London! After arriving at the airport, make your way to your hotel to check-in and freshen up. Once you're ready, head out to explore the city's heart, The Mall. Begin your journey with a delightful stroll along this iconic road, lined with majestic trees and flanked by historic landmarks. Take in the impressive views and soak in the atmosphere of royal grandeur. Spend the evening exploring nearby attractions such as Trafalgar Square and Covent Garden, bustling with shops, eateries, and street performances.

  • The Mall: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Trafalgar Square: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Covent Garden: Free, 2-3 hours

Saturday, December 16: Museums and Cultural Delights

Dive into London's rich cultural heritage by visiting its world-class museums. Start your day at the British Museum, home to a vast collection of art and antiquities from around the world. Explore the exhibits at your own pace and marvel at iconic artifacts like the Rosetta Stone. In the afternoon, head to the Victoria and Albert Museum to admire its extensive collection of art, design, and fashion. Round off the day with a visit to the Natural History Museum, where you can discover fascinating exhibits on nature and science.

  • British Museum: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Victoria and Albert Museum: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Natural History Museum: Free, 2-3 hours

Sunday, December 17: Historical Landmarks and River Thames

Today, explore London's iconic historical landmarks. Begin your morning with a trip to the Tower of London,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Discover its rich history, view the Crown Jewels, and witness the famous ceremonial guards. Afterward, take a leisurely stroll along the South Bank of the River Thames, enjoying breathtaking views of the city's skyline. Visit the Shakespeare's Globe Theatre and cross the iconic Tower Bridge for panoramic vistas. Wrap up your day with a visit to the vibrant Camden Market, a hub of unique shops and delicious street food.

  • Tower of London: £25 (~INR 2474), 2-3 hours
  • South Bank of the River Thames: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Shakespeare's Globe Theatre: £17 (~INR 1680), 1-2 hours
  • Tower Bridge: £10 (~INR 990), 1-2 hours
  • Camden Market: Free, 2-3 hours

Monday, December 18: Royal London and Green Spaces

Get a glimpse into the royal history and enjoy the green spaces of London. Begin your morning with a visit to the majestic Buckingham Palace, the official residence of the British monarch. Witness the Changing of the Guard ceremony if scheduled. Afterward, head to Kensington Gardens and explore its beautiful landscapes and famous landmarks like the Royal Albert Hall and Kew Gardens. In the evening, enjoy a serene stroll along the Green Park and discover its peaceful atmosphere.

  • Buckingham Palace: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Kensington Gardens: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Green Park: Free, 1-2 hours

Tuesday, December 19: West End Musical and Shopping

Indulge in a thrilling West End musical experience today. Spend your morning exploring the vibrant shopping district of Oxford Street. Discover an array of high-street brands and luxury boutiques. In the afternoon, make your way to the West End and immerse yourself in an acclaimed musical at one of the iconic theaters like Her Majesty's Theatre or Cambridge Theatre. Let the enchanting performances leave you mesmerized. After the show, explore the vibrant nightlife of Soho with its bustling bars and diverse cuisine.

  • Oxford Street: Variable costs, 2-3 hours
  • West End Musical: £50-100 (~INR 4950-9900), 3-4 hours
  • Soho: Variable costs, 2-3 hours

Wednesday, December 20: Greenwich Exploration

Head to the historic district of Greenwich today, located on the banks of the River Thames. Start your day by visiting the National Maritime Museum to delve into British naval history. Explore the Royal Observatory and stand on the Prime Meridian Line. Enjoy panoramic views of London from Greenwich Park and admire the majestic Old Royal Naval College. End your day with a relaxing stroll along the picturesque streets of Greenwich and savor a delightful meal at one of its charming restaurants.

  • National Maritime Museum: £15(~INR 1485), 2-3 hours
  • Royal Observatory: £16.50 (~INR 1633), 1-2 hours
  • Greenwich Park: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Old Royal Naval College: Free, 1-2 hours

Thursday, December 21: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

London is full of hidden gems and local favorites that captivate the imagination. Explore the picturesque district of Columbia Road, known for its charming flower market. Enjoy the vibrant colors and fragrances as you stroll through the market and soak up the authentic atmosphere. Nearby is Design Museum, a treasure trove for design enthusiasts. Discover innovative exhibits and gain insights into the world of design. In the evening, venture to the colorful neighborhood of Portobello Road in Notting Hill. Explore its antique shops, boutique stores, and delightful cafes.
